Goal. Synthesis and study of the effect of the inhibitory component – sterically complicated acenaphthene compounds – on the effectiveness of the protective composition to prevent corrosion of metal products during the period of temporary preservation.Method. Coke-chemical acenaphthylene was isolated from the absorbing and anthracene fractions of coal tar, the bromination of which led to 1,2-dibromocenaphthene. Subsequent alkylation of azine bases with 1,2-dibromacenaphthene yielded a number of sterically complex acenaphthene compounds. In the conditions of simulation aggressiveness of NSS environment the influence of synthesized additives on efficiency of anticorrosive composition is investigated (ISO 9227:2017). Research methods: chromatography, synthesis, elemental analysis, IR spectroscopy, corrosion tests.Results. On the basis of low-demand, available and inexpensive components of coke production, a number of substances with high anti-corrosion properties were synthesized – Quaternary azine salts with acenaphthene fragment. It was determined that the greatest resistance to the destructive effects of corrosive NSS environment according to the results of accelerated atmospheric corrosion tests was demonstrated by a composite coating containing an inhibitory additive – 1-(2-bromo-1,2-dihydroacenaphthylen-1-yl) quinoline bromide. The dominant role of the structure of the inhibitory additive on the manifestation of anticorrosive properties of the protective composition is shown. The influence of the ratio of components of paints and varnishes on their technological and anti-corrosion properties has been studied. The obtained results allow to create a new formulation of the domestic competitive protective composition to prevent corrosion of the metal for the period of temporary preservation.Scientific novelty. The role of 1,2-dibromacenaphthene as a promising alkylating agent in the synthesis of inhibitory additives - sterically complicated acenaphthene compounds has been determined.Practical significance. The optimal content of inhibitory components – Quaternary azine salts with acenaphthene fragment – for the development of a formulation of an effective anti-corrosion composition for the period of temporary preservation of metal products.

Abstract Scientific findings have indicated that psychological and social factors are the driving forces behind most chronic benign pain presentations, especially in a claim context, and are relevant to at least three of the AMA Guides publications: AMA Guides to Evaluation of Disease and Injury Causation, AMA Guides to Work Ability and Return to Work, and AMA Guides to the Evaluation of Permanent Impairment. The author reviews and summarizes studies that have identified the dominant role of financial, psychological, and other non–general medicine factors in patients who report low back pain. For example, one meta-analysis found that compensation results in an increase in pain perception and a reduction in the ability to benefit from medical and psychological treatment. Other studies have found a correlation between the level of compensation and health outcomes (greater compensation is associated with worse outcomes), and legal systems that discourage compensation for pain produce better health outcomes. One study found that, among persons with carpal tunnel syndrome, claimants had worse outcomes than nonclaimants despite receiving more treatment; another examined the problematic relationship between complex regional pain syndrome (CRPS) and compensation and found that cases of CRPS are dominated by legal claims, a disparity that highlights the dominant role of compensation. Workers’ compensation claimants are almost never evaluated for personality disorders or mental illness. The article concludes with recommendations that evaluators can consider in individual cases.

Эти данные демонстрируют климатогеографические, экологические и другие региональные особенности в распространении респираторной аллергии.The review article presents data on the prevalence of respiratory allergy - allergic rhinitis and bronchial asthma in southern Russia, published over the past decades. The dominant role of pollen allergy is shown in almost the entire southern region of Russia. In the Chechen Republic, sensitization to house dust mites and grass pollen was found in patients with respiratory allergy equally (51.1 and 52.5, respectively), whereas ragweed and mugwort sensitization was 3 times less (26.6 and 20.7, respectively) compared with the neighboring regions of southern Russia. These data demonstrate climate-geographical, environmental and other regional features in the prevalence of respiratory allergies.

After had being carried out nationalization and hostility against west countries, the New Order regime made important decision to change Indonesia economic direction from etatism system to free market economy. A set of policies were taken in order private sector could play major role in economic. However, when another economic sectors were reformed substantially, effords to reform the State Owned Enterprises had failed. The State Owned Enterprise, in fact, remained to play dominant role like early years of guided democracy era. Role of the State Owned Enterprises was more and more powerfull). The main problem of reforms finally lied on reality that vested interest of bureaucrats (civil or military) was so large that could’nt been overcome.

The concluding chapter highlights how the cultural history of graphic signs of authority in late antiquity and the early Middle Ages encapsulated the profound transformation of political culture in the Mediterranean and Europe from approximately the fourth to ninth centuries. It also reflects on the transcendent sources of authority in these historical periods, and the role of graphic signs in highlighting this connection. Finally, it warns that, despite the apparent dominant role of the sign of the cross and cruciform graphic devices in providing access to transcendent protection and support in ninth-century Western Europe, some people could still employ alternative graphic signs deriving from older occult traditions in their recourse to transcendent powers.

This article presents a study of Twitter-based communication in order to identify key influencers and to assess the role of their communication in shaping country images. The analysis is based on a 2-month dataset comprised of all tweets including hashtags of the three countries selected for this study: Austria, Switzerland, and the Netherlands. Following a two-step flow model of communication, we initially identified the influential Twitter users in all three countries based on their centrality measures. Subsequently, we carried out a qualitative content analysis of tweets posted by these influential users. Finally, we assessed the similarities and differences across the three country cases. This article offers new insights into public diplomacy 2.0 activities by discussing influence within the context of country images and demonstrating how opinion leaders can play a more dominant role than states or other political actors in creating and disseminating content related to country image. The findings also provide practical insights in the production of a country’s image and its representation on new media platforms.
